Severe weather warning issued for Jersey

On Monday, Storm Ana felled trees across the Island and left a number of roads flooded. Ferry services to France were also cancelled.

Now Jersey Met has issued an orange level wind warning – the second-highest level of alert – for severe gale force nine west to north-westerly winds with gusts up to 69 mph in the Channel Islands area.

The worst of the winds are expected overnight on Wednesday.

By Friday the winds will have swung round to the north, bringing colder conditions.
